Vibe Coding vs Agentic Engineering
Um olhar rápido e direto sobre a diferença entre vibe coding e agentic engineering.

A IA está mudando a forma como construímos software. Dois termos que aparecem muito nessa conversa são vibe coding e agentic engineering.
Eles parecem semelhantes, mas representam níveis diferentes de disciplina.
O que é vibe coding?
Vibe coding é uma forma mais casual de construir com IA. Você descreve o que quer, o modelo gera o código, e você vai ajustando o resultado por meio de prompts.
É útil quando você quer ir rápido, testar uma ideia ou montar um pequeno protótipo. O foco está no momentum e na experimentação.
Em termos simples: vibe coding é deixar a IA te ajudar a criar algo rapidamente.
O que é agentic engineering?
Agentic engineering é uma forma mais estruturada de trabalhar com agents de IA. O engenheiro continua usando IA, mas com objetivos mais claros, melhor contexto, revisões, testes e julgamento técnico.
Em vez de só pedir código e aceitar o que vem, o engenheiro guia o agent, valida as decisões e mantém a régua de qualidade alta.
Em termos simples: agentic engineering é usar agents de IA como colaboradores poderosos sem abrir mão do processo de engenharia.
A principal diferença
Vibe coding ajuda mais pessoas a começarem a construir software. Agentic engineering ajuda engenheiros experientes a construírem software melhor e mais rápido.
Vibe coding é ótimo para exploração. Agentic engineering é melhor para trabalho em produção.
O futuro provavelmente não é um ou outro. Os melhores devs vão saber quando acelerar no vibe e quando desacelerar para especificar, revisar, testar e fazer engenharia com intenção.
25 de abril de 2026 · Brazil